Costa Rica Holiday Homestay

Discover the Real Costa Rica: Language, Culture, and Local Living in San Gerardo de Rivas

Costa Rica Holiday Homestay offers a unique way to experience Costa Rica beyond typical tourist paths. Located in San Gerardo de Rivas, this language school and homestay program introduces travelers to the authentic culture and lifestyle of the Talamanca Mountains region. Just 20 kilometers from San Isidro de El General, this quaint village of about 350 people, including locals and expatriates, provides an intimate glimpse into the true essence of Costa Rican life.

Discover San Gerardo de Rivas

San Gerardo de Rivas is not only known for its proximity to Chirripรณ National Park but also for its rich local culture. The surrounding region is home to several attractions that visitors can enjoy, including:

  • Cloudbridge Nature Reserve: A stunning private reserve that offers various scenic trails, wildlife viewing opportunities, and the chance to see the pristine Chirripรณ River cascading down from the highlands.
  • Art and Culture Tour: This self-guided tour takes visitors along forested paths, scenic ridges, and local country roads, passing by beautiful gardens, swimming holes, micro-businesses, and community landmarks. Friendly residents are eager to share their culture, and many local artisans offer handcrafted items reflecting traditional Costa Rican life.
  • Local Eateries and Markets: Guests can explore a variety of local spots, from cheese makers and organic chocolate artisans to small farmers’ markets showcasing fresh produce, coffee, and traditional foods. It’s a perfect way to support local businesses and gain a deeper appreciation for the region.
